Blender is a free and open-source 3D computer graphiBlender is a free and open-source 3D computer graphics software tool set used for creating animated films, visual effects, art, 3D-printed models, motion graphics, interactive 3D applications, virtual reality, and, formerly, video games.

1. Animated Films: Blender allows artists to create animated films, providing tools for modeling, rigging, animation, simulation, rendering, and more.

2. Visual Effects (VFX): Professionals use Blender for creating visual effects in films and videos, such as explosions, particle effects, and compositing.

3. Art and 3D Printing: Artists can use Blender for digital sculpting and modeling, creating detailed 3D artworks. The software is also utilized in the process of preparing 3D models for 3D printing.

4. Motion Graphics: Blender offers tools for motion graphics, enabling the creation of dynamic and animated graphical elements for videos and presentations.

5. Interactive 3D Applications: Blender allows developers to create interactive 3D applications and experiences, making it useful for virtual tours, simulations, and games.

6. Virtual Reality (VR): Blender supports the creation of content for virtual reality experiences, allowing artists to design immersive environments.

7. Video Game Development: While Blender was formerly used for creating video games, it is not as common as other specialized game development tools. However, it can still be used for aspects like 3D modeling and animation in game development pipelines.


Blender's user community is active and continually contributes to its development, making it a valuable resource for artists, animators, and developers seeking powerful 3D graphics software without the financial constraints of commercial alternatives.

8. Simulation: Blender includes robust simulation tools for physics-based animations, such as fluid simulations, smoke and fire simulations, cloth simulations, and more. These features are crucial for creating realistic and dynamic animations.

9. Node-Based Compositing: Blender has a node-based compositor that allows users to create complex post-processing effects, enhance renders, and combine different elements seamlessly.

10.Grease Pencil: Blender's Grease Pencil tool enables artists to draw directly in 3D space, allowing for the creation of 2D animations or annotations within a 3D scene.

11.Python Scripting: Blender supports Python scripting, allowing users to automate tasks, create custom tools, and extend the functionality of the software. This makes it a flexible and customizable tool for advanced users.

12.Rigging and Character Animation: Blender provides tools for character rigging and animation, allowing artists to create articulated characters with realistic movements.

13.UV Mapping and Texturing: Artists can unwrap 3D models and apply textures using Blender's UV mapping tools. The software supports the creation and editing of textures for realistic surface details.

14.Open Shading Language (OSL): Blender supports OSL, a shading language that allows users to write custom shaders for advanced and realistic material rendering.

15.3D Viewport: Blender's 3D viewport is highly customizable, providing various shading modes, overlays, and options for efficient modeling, sculpting, and animation workflows.

16.Add-ons: Blender's functionality can be extended through add-ons, which are additional scripts or tools created by the community to enhance specific features or add new capabilities.

17.Cross-Platform Compatibility: Blender is available for Windows, macOS, and Linux, making it accessible to a wide range of users regardless of their operating system.

Blender's continuous development and its active community contribute to its evolution, ensuring that it remains a competitive and feature-rich tool for 3D content creation.
